Candolim Beach

Candolim Beach is one of the most beautiful and popular beaches of North Goa. Candolim Beach is more peaceful than rest of other Goan beaches. This long and straight beach is backed by scrub-covered dunes. As located in North Goa, Candolim is the first beach when enters from Panaji. Aguda Fort and Calangute Beach are the prime attractions here. Beginning at Fort Aguada and ending at Chapora Beach, Candolim Beach is a part of a long stretch of beach coastline along Arabian Sea. This beach is really ideal place for those who are slowly getting tired of the crowded beaches like Anjuna and Calangute. Some of the hotels here offer Yoga and Meditation session. Beach also offers some adventure activities like Fishing, Parasailing and Water skiing. One can also enjoy sunbathing and swimming here. A number of inns at Candolim have really excellent facilities. The beach offers some of the best seafood of Goa. The town is also the birth place of Abbe Faria, one of the Great Goan Freedom Fighters and also the Father of Hypnotism.

Attractions Around Candolim Beach

Candolim Beach houses some of the famous tourist attractions of Goa. Fort Aguada, built in 1612 by the Portuguese is the prime attraction of the beach. This mighty fort in Goa is worth visiting. Candolim and Calangute are two beaches which lie on the northern side of this fort. This beach is also suitable for fishing and other activities. Some trips organized by professionals also include breaks for swimming and offer lunch in a heritage house and delightful dolphin watching boat trips. Beach also offers some of the fun activities which include parasailing, water scooters, snokerelling, fishing and crocodile spotting trips and boat rides. Neighboring beaches offer additional water-sports action. This beach is also well known for its Yoga and Meditation sessions.

The Best Time to Visit

If you want are visiting Candolim, the best time to visit is from December to February.

How To Reach Candolim Beach

A number of buses help people to reach from Mapusa and Calangute to Candolim. Mapusa, a KTC bus station, is the nearest interstate bus station. Buses from Panjim stop at the bus stand opposite to the Casa Sea Shell frequently. Some of the buses also continue south to Fort Aguada Beach Resort. Services depart from here onwards very frequently for the capital via Nerul village. Taxi service is also available outside the major resort hotels.
